Output 29f037d40b1009b1e8d73ddbd77d87605da0a1b518cf65a0e69a47ab135644c8:0

value
2006738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8aef26f5ea0f72d62444ea8d3753c58e625395 OP_EQUAL
address
MPdUtjyB6sB184smR8xsLCtH6xMUAqcYGg
transaction
29f037d40b1009b1e8d73ddbd77d87605da0a1b518cf65a0e69a47ab135644c8
spent
true